引言
随着科技的不断进步,智能家居市场正迎来前所未有的发展机遇。布洛克MR(Mixed Reality)作为一项前沿技术,正在引领家居行业的革新。本文将深入探讨布洛克MR在智能家居中的应用,以及它如何改变我们的生活方式。
布洛克MR技术概述
布洛克MR是一种结合了真实世界和虚拟世界的混合现实技术。它通过特殊的设备,如MR眼镜,将虚拟元素叠加到现实环境中,使用户能够与虚拟世界互动,同时保持对现实世界的感知。
布洛克MR在智能家居中的应用
1. 虚拟家居设计
布洛克MR技术使得用户可以在购买家具前,通过虚拟现实的方式预览家居效果。用户可以站在自己的房间内,通过MR眼镜看到家具的1:1模型,并根据实际空间进行调整,从而避免装修后的实际效果与预期不符。
```python
# 以下为布洛克MR虚拟家居设计的示例代码
importブロックMR_API
# 创建虚拟家居模型
def create_virtual_furniture(model_name, room_dimensions):
virtual_furniture = ブロックMR_API.create_model(model_name, room_dimensions)
return virtual_furniture
# 用户选择家具并预览
def preview_furniture(user_choice, room):
virtual_furniture = create_virtual_furniture(user_choice, room)
ブロックMR_API.render(virtual_furniture, room)
# 用户可以调整家具位置和方向
2. 智能家居控制
布洛克MR眼镜可以集成智能家居控制功能,用户通过简单的手势或语音指令,即可控制家中的智能设备,如灯光、温度、安全系统等。
```python
# 以下为布洛克MR智能家居控制的示例代码
import ブロックMR_API
# 控制家居设备
def control_home_device(device_name, action):
ブロックMR_API.control_device(device_name, action)
# 用户通过MR眼镜控制灯光
def control_lights():
control_home_device("lights", "on")
3. 家庭娱乐
布洛克MR技术可以带来全新的家庭娱乐体验。用户可以通过MR眼镜观看3D电影、玩游戏,甚至与虚拟角色互动。
```python
# 以下为布洛克MR家庭娱乐的示例代码
import ブロックMR_API
# 初始化家庭娱乐系统
def init_entertainment_system():
ブロックMR_API.init_system()
# 用户观看3D电影
def watch_3d_movie(movie_name):
init_entertainment_system()
ブロックMR_API.play_movie(movie_name)
布洛克MR的挑战与机遇
虽然布洛克MR技术在智能家居领域具有巨大的潜力,但同时也面临着一些挑战,如技术成本、用户体验和安全性等问题。
结论
布洛克MR技术正在引领智能家居的革新,为我们的生活带来更多便利和可能性。作为用户,我们需要准备好迎接这场变革,并积极拥抱新的生活方式。